首页
学习
活动
专区
圈层
工具
发布
社区首页 >问答首页 >无法在Netbeans 7.3中测试RESTful get服务,如何在路径中删除额外的"/“

无法在Netbeans 7.3中测试RESTful get服务,如何在路径中删除额外的"/“
EN

Stack Overflow用户
提问于 2013-03-07 19:14:38
回答 1查看 3K关注 0票数 1

也许这个问题很愚蠢,但我还是会试一试:

我正在使用Netbeans 7.3,我想从集成开发环境中测试RESTful IDE服务。

当我右键单击我的服务并说“test Resource Uri”时,我得到以下消息:

无法打开资源URL:

代码语言:javascript
复制
http://localhost:8080//ads-api/rs/ads

ads-api是我的war文件的名称

由于某些原因,Netbeans在路径中添加了额外的"/“,就在端口号之后。

即使我在配置中将path指定为ads-api/rs,它也总是被/ads-api/rs覆盖。所以,我想,我应该去掉http://localhost:8080/中的"/“,但是我不知道在哪里可以找到它(它是从命令行运行的Netbeans 4.2,但在JBoss中是可见的)

有谁可以帮我?在此之前,非常感谢您。

EN

回答 1

Stack Overflow用户

发布于 2014-02-05 18:00:03

双斜杠不是问题所在,因为您可以在此处重现:

http://news.yahoo.com/world/

http://news.yahoo.com//world/

两个链接都工作得很好。因此,要么是JBoss-Server有问题,要么更有可能是项目中的rest配置有问题。您可以尝试让Netbeans基于实体类或数据库表通过向导自动创建rest端点。所以你可以看看一个有效的解决方案,只是为了学习。

票数 1
EN
页面原文内容由Stack Overflow提供。腾讯云小微IT领域专用引擎提供翻译支持
原文链接:

https://stackoverflow.com/questions/15269703

复制
相关文章

相似问题

领券
问题归档专栏文章快讯文章归档关键词归档开发者手册归档开发者手册 Section 归档